Output 81bb99dd0b0983a40bc3abaf28afc894f1c0a5c2650f72287a70b38bb764fc92:3

value
46394303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8baa328898fce5bc81df2925a91b57f742a5947a OP_EQUAL
address
MLde3ck3vNpGgmGYtuFdWkmFGr1TiKLa6A
transaction
81bb99dd0b0983a40bc3abaf28afc894f1c0a5c2650f72287a70b38bb764fc92
spent
true